How To Create An Affiliate Niche Site - JohnChow made an excellent post on affiliate niche sites and how to create a really great landing page that will convert! I have know about this setup for sometime but never thought about doing a post on it! That’s why JohnChow is still the money making guru that he is!

The 3 Little Web Entrepreneurs - This is an older post but Tyler Cruz did such an awesome job on it that I had to bring it up! He creates a story out of the simple fact that YouTube banned him and he ended up using Viddler instead! Its very clever and I know you all will enjoy it as I did!

Being a Useful Twitter User [and receiving followers in the process] - Ryan Barr guest posted on Darren Roses newest blog TwiTips.com and Ryan shows how to be a good twitter user and get followers out of it. Its a very nice post and is easy to understand! Check it out!

4 More Free WordPress Themes Hot Off The Press - Does SuiteJ ever disappoint? In this post he points out 4 new wordpress themes that are out of this world (literally) check it out and let Jay know where you came from!

Who Cares About Google Pagerank? - Kevin John Lewis wrote an excellent post about Google Pagerank, this one is worth reading even if your not into pagerank! Knowledge is key people and KJ is great at giving it!

Converting First Time Visitors to Loyal Readers - Darren never disappoints me and this series of posts is one of the best on the net today. Even if you already have an established blog is worth reading over and over to get new ideas and spice up your blog with goodness!
